Negligent security cases arise when an individual is injured or killed because of carelessness or neglect on the part of property owners and businesses. Such cases may include rape and assaults in parking lots, apartment buildings, hotels, stores, and other businesses.
People have a right to personal safety while they are on someone else’s business property. Businesses have a duty to provide reasonably safe environments for their clients and customers. If property owners do not conform with this duty, they may be liable for injuries to people on their property. Negligent security cases generally involve an injury to an individual as a result of an injury on a third parties premises.
